2021 Pan Ham Contest

During your travels, take the image of P.D. Gwaltney Jr. and his ham with you and document a great vacation moment with a photo of the image.

Whatever your plans are – the beach, the mountains, a road trip or a staycation in your own backyard – be sure to pack the World’s Oldest Ham. He is ready for an adventure!

Download the image below, and post submissions on our Facebook site, tweet it to the World's Oldest Ham or email it to the museum.

​All entrants will be entered into a random drawing for a prize.
